What this programme builds

Our school-ready stars.

Early reading

Stories, letter sounds, vocabulary, and guided reading activities build a strong literacy foundation.

Writing confidence

Children practise mark-making, letter formation, names, and simple written expression.

Counting skills

Numbers, patterns, sorting, and practical problem-solving prepare children for Grade 1 mathematics.

Independent learners

Classroom routines, responsibility, friendship, and self-confidence support a positive move into primary school.

Common questions

What parents usually ask.

Which curriculum do you follow?+

We follow the Namibian Early Childhood Curriculum and prepare children for the expectations of Grade 1.

How do you support Grade 1 readiness?+

Children practise early reading, writing, counting, classroom routines, problem-solving, and independent work.

Is learning still play-based?+

Yes. Structured activities are balanced with purposeful play, movement, stories, music, and creative exploration.
